    A Single Hand Fold Stroller Is Easy to Use and Fits Into Tight Spaces

    A stroller should be easy to maneuver and fit in tiny spaces. This model folds with just one hand, and is ideal to travel with.

    It also has a large undercarriage storage basket, a reclining seat, and a large canopy with a peek-a-boo window. It's only downside is it's too big to fit in overhead bins for airlines.

    Whether you are traveling to work or for vacation, picking the right stroller for your needs can make or break your trip. Consider the weight and age of your child and features like a wide recline, ample storage and weather protection. Select a model that you can fold and unfold with one hand. This is particularly important when you're holding the child's weight.

    The egg2 was a great choice for us due to its compact fold, light weight and sturdy feel. It also comes with an adjustable recline mechanism, a huge basket under the seat, and the handbar is extremely comfortable. The only downsides are a stiff leg rest and the limited storage space. The leg rest and basket could fit a small tote bag but you'll need to take off the cushion in order to do so. The seat doesn't have an ample pocket. This can be a problem when you're trying to juggle multiple bags and a squirmy child.

    If you are seeking a single-handle model that is less expensive, then you should look into the GBQbit+ All City. It's similar to the Nuna Trvl in many ways with one-hand folding as well as an accessible leg rest. It doesn't have the same amount of undercarriage storage as other models, and its canopy is smaller.

    In our tests we were awestruck by the GB Qbit+ All City's smooth ride on a variety of surfaces. It was easy to roll over paved sidewalks and shag carpet and performed well in our tests of durability. In addition, it offers numerous options for customization such as a bassinet for a baby attachment and a riderboard for older siblings.

    A good option for parents who travel frequently, this lightweight stroller folds in half and fits in an overhead bin of a plane or train. It has a sleek, modern design with an encasement in the front for parents' phones and a larger one in the back for larger bags or weekenders. The cushioned seat is well designed, and the buckling system is equipped with magnetic buckles that are simple to use and quick to secure, even with a toddler in tow. It's also one of only a few models that we tested with brake feet, making it easy to stop when needed.

    Design

    If you're planning to travel with a stroller make sure you choose one that is easy to fold and carry and transport with other luggage. Some of these strollers have straps or a carrying case that allow you to carry them over your shoulder. These strollers are ideal for long days of exploring or for navigating narrow aisles on public transportation.

    The Nuna Trvl is one of GH's top one-handed stroller. It's a light travel jogger that's easy-to-handle, has a deep reclining seat and a large storage bag. It looks fantastic, is easy to maneuver and can make sharp turns.

    The GB Qbit+ All City is another excellent option for a lightweight and compact stroller that is easy to carry. It is similar to the Nuna Trvl, but it's slightly cheaper and has some additional convenience features. This includes an adjustable legrest as well as a recline system that is nearly all the way back.

    Other notable strollers that are lightweight include the Cybex Orfeo (which earned a spot on our best car seat travel systems list) as well as the UPPAbaby Minu and the GB Pockit. The Cybex Orfeo is compatible with six car seat brands and features an all-hands-on-one-hand, self-standing fold. It's heavier than the other top models in this category however, and its front wheel could be better in absorbing bumps.

    The UPPAbaby Mini offers many of the same features as the larger prams of the company, but folds more compactly. It is able to fit into the majority of overhead bins on airplanes. The padding on the seat is substantial and the recline system comes with two settings that are simple to operate. It also comes with a great, unstructured rear storage pouch and a locking clasp which keeps the stroller folded when in transit.

    The BabyZen YoYo2 is a popular stroller that's especially suited for families traveling. It's super-light (13.7 pounds) and has a compact, compact fold that allows it to easily fit into airplane aisles and overhead bins, and offers decent features for the money. It is compatible with many car seat brands, and it's one of the lightest strollers you can buy.

    It is difficult to maneuver. It has a narrow base and small undercarriage storage capacity, which can make it less suitable for longer journeys or errands. It's not the most smooth on all terrains and has a habit of rocking on bumps. The newer version has a more comfortable and cushioned seat, but it's not as expensive.

    In general, we prefer single-handed strollers with brakes that are easy to lock and a spacious undercarriage to store things. We also recommend a cushioned harness and seat for comfort, a handy cup holder for parents and a foot brake that's easy to use.

    The Silver Cross Jet 4 is one of the best single-hand folding strollers on the market. It folds in just four seconds using just one hand, however it does take a moment to click into place. Its slim frame can be easily tucked away in overhead bins and can be moved like a suitcase down 19-inch aisles of airplanes. The canopy provides ample protection from the sun, and the fabric is strong. There are two cup holders as well as a tray for parents.

    The Uppababy Cruz is another excellent stroller that can be folded by just one hand. It has a wide seat that has deep recline and plenty of legroom. Its sleek design allows it to be maneuvered even on rough surfaces. Its front wheels were specially made for India's rough roads and it has an insulated brake that is connected to it. The Cruz is not suitable for long walks as it does not come with an accessory strap for carrying.

    The Quick is another excellent stroller for travel that comes with top features in a light and compact 12.8-lb design. Its sleek frame can accommodate 30 different car seats for toddlers and infants that weigh up to 50 pounds. It's compatible with all carrycots, 9324874 infant carriers, and infant car seat. It comes with a strap for carrying it over your shoulder.
